Cardholders whose accounts are designated for the trust portfolio had billing addresses in all 50 states, the District of Columbia and other U.S. territories, except for approximately 0.25% of the principal receivables balance for the trust for which cardholders had billing addresses located outside of the United States, the District of Columbia or other U.S. territories. Except for the five states listed below, no state accounted for more than 5% of the number of accounts or 5% of the total principal receivables balances as of August 31, 2019.
Composition by Billing Address
Trust Portfolio
State | | Percentage of Total Number of Accounts | | Percentage of Total Principal Receivables |
Texas | | 8.46% | | 11.24% |
California | | 9.09% | | 10.41% |
Florida | | 7.50% | | 7.57% |
New York | | 7.53% | | 7.01% |
Illinois | | 4.61% | | 5.27% |
The bank uses credit bureau scoring and a proprietary scoring model developed for the bank as tools in the underwriting process and for making credit decisions. The bank uses credit bureau scoring and a proprietary scoring model also for purposes of monitoring obligor credit quality. The bank’s proprietary scoring model is based on historical data and requires the bank to make various assumptions about future performance. As a result, the bank’s proprietary model is not intended, and should not be relied upon, to forecast actual future performance.
Information regarding customer performance is factored into these proprietary scoring models to determine the probability of an account becoming 91 or more days past due or becoming charged off at any time within the next 12 months. Obligor credit quality is monitored at least monthly during the life of an account. The information in the table below is based on the most recent information available for each account in the trust portfolio. Because the future composition of the trust portfolio will change over time, obligor credit quality as shown in the table below is not indicative of obligor credit quality for the trust portfolio at any subsequent time. In addition, the bank’s assessment of obligor credit quality may change over time depending on the conduct of the cardholder and changes in the proprietary scoring models used by the bank.
